Trust yourself as a parent and become more intentional in your caregiving choices with practical, easy advice, tips, and exercises from wellness expert Mallika Chopra and family therapist Kanika P. Chopra. 

Parenting offers incredible gifts: watching, guiding, and celebrating a child as they navigate their unique journey as a human...
